The poverty pork schnitzel sandwich is a hearty and flavorful version of the classic Chilean dish, perfect for a weekend lunch or casual dinner. This recipe combines the crispy breaded pork escalope with french fries, caramelized onions, and fried egg, all piled onto a fresh marraqueta roll. It's a dish that satisfies even the most demanding cravings, ideal for those seeking comforting and flavor-packed food.
Origin and variations
The name "a lo pobre" refers to a traditional Chilean preparation that includes potatoes, onions, and eggs, affordable ingredients that accompany the meat. This sandwich version is a modern twist, very popular in food trucks and fast-food restaurants. You can vary the type of bread (use burger buns or ciabatta) or add avocado and tomato for a fresh touch.
Tips for a perfect escalope
- Pound the escalopes until they are quite thin so they cook quickly and stay tender.
- Let the breaded escalopes rest in the refrigerator before frying; this helps the coating adhere.
- Fry the potatoes in two stages: first at medium temperature to cook them through, then at high to crisp them.

Directions
-
1
Place the pork scallops one by one between plastic film and hit them on both sides with a kitchen hammer.
-
2
Mix the garlic, parsley, oregano, salt, pepper in a bowl and season the scallops on both sides.
-
3
Coat the scallops in flour mixed with a little salt, egg and breadcrumbs.
-
4
Let it rest in the refrigerator for 1 hour so that the breadcrumbs adhere well to the scallops.
-
5
Fry the scallops and leave them on absorbent paper towels.
-
6
Cut the potatoes into sticks, with or without skin.
-
7
Fry the potatoes until golden brown.
-
8
Heat a pan and brown or caramelise the onion to the point you want. Fry the eggs to your liking.
-
9
Cut the marraquettes in half lengthwise.
-
10
On the bottom cover, place the fried pork schnitzels, caramelized onion and on top of the fried egg.
-
11
Serve the sandwich with French fries.
